How to arrive

Villa Brunella sits at the end of Via Tragara, Capri's most iconic street. Reaching it means a comfortable 15-minute walk from the Piazzetta. The arrival is part of the stay, and the concierge helps coordinate it before check-in.

Marina Piccola seen from Villa Brunella

What is nearby

The Tragara walk, the Belvedere facing the Faraglioni, Via Camerelle and its boutiques, the path down to the sea, Da Luigi and La Fontelina beach clubs: you are in the heart of Capri.

View over Marina Piccola bay

Luggage & mobility

The hotel concierge can organize luggage transport from the port to the hotel, so you can enjoy the arrival without carrying bags along the walk.

15 min The Piazzetta in Capri, funicular stop, bus stops for routes across the island, and taxi rank

16 min Gardens of Augustus and Via Krupp

12 min The Charterhouse of San Giacomo

9 min Via Camerelle: shopping, restaurants, etc.

Hotel Villa Brunella

2 min Tragara scenic overlook facing the Faraglioni

3 min The Pizzolungo Trail (we recommend walking from the Natural Arch towards the Tragara scenic overlook)

20 min La Fontelina and Da Luigi ai Faraglioni beach clubs

Frequently asked questions

When is Hotel Villa Brunella open?

Usually from mid-April to the third week of October.

How do I get from Capri port to the hotel?

The concierge can coordinate transfer timing and porter support before arrival.

How many rooms does Villa Brunella have?

Twenty rooms across five categories.

What makes Villa Brunella different from other hotels in Capri?

Small scale and an atmosphere closer to a family villa than to showy luxury.

What happens if weather conditions affect travel to Capri?

The team stays in touch with ferry companies and helps reorganize your trip if needed.

Is the hotel good for honeymoons?

Yes, especially for couples looking for a quieter, more private kind of luxury.

Is the restaurant open to non-guests?

Yes, L'Agave welcomes outside guests by reservation.

Do you have sea-view rooms?

Yes, including room categories with sea-view terraces.

Is direct booking worth it?

Yes, because the relationship with the concierge starts before you arrive.

Is the atmosphere more romantic or family-oriented?

Quiet and romantic. The setting is adults-only, the architecture is Caprese, and the pace is deliberately slow.

Can the concierge organize beach clubs and dining?

Yes, and it is one of the strongest reasons to book direct.

How close is the hotel to the Faraglioni area?

The villa sits in the final stretch of Via Tragara, near the Belvedere facing the Faraglioni and the path toward La Fontelina.

What kind of stay is Villa Brunella best for?

For couples who like to walk and want a local, quiet-luxury atmosphere rather than fashionable places.
